Performa conquers the Nordic chocolate packaging market
Stora Enso Oyj
Published on

Iceland is the latest country to adopt Stora Enso´s Performa Natura CTMP board for packaging chocolate. The use of the board by confectioner Nói Síríus of Iceland means that it is now used by all leading Nordic chocolate manufacturers. This breakthrough comes at a time when Stora Enso is planning to introduce a new member of the Performa family. During summer this year Performa Cream will be launched.

Pedestrian protection
Autoliv Inc.
Published on

At the international vehicle safety conference ESV in Amsterdam on June 4-7, automotive safety specialist Autoliv launches a new system to protect pedestrians when struck by cars. The new system could significantly reduce the risk for serious and fatal head injuries.

Smoking indoors without problems will be possible with aSwedish-designed smoking station
Smoke Free Systems AB
Published on
From now on, non-smokers will be able to have unrestricted communication with their smoking colleagues without being exposed to passive smoking or odour problems. So says the manufacturer of a special smoking station, Smoke Free Systems AB, which already has its first 1 000 units in use in Swedish work places. Up to six people are able to smoke at the same time without their fumes spreading or polluting the indoor environment. All it takes is an electrical socket, two square metres of floor space and normal general ventilation to eliminate tobacco smoke and its odours in the work environment.
Free-standing air cleaner in a table to improve the environment and increase hotel room occupancy
Airtable AB
Published on

Airtable is the name of an air cleaner in the form of a table, that will improve the hotel room environment for both guests and staff. It does this by removing approximately 90% of tobacco smoke and particles from the room through a specially-designed filter. Apart from leading to increased room occupancy, the manufacturer claims that satisfied guests will spread goodwill, whilst room cleaning time is reduced.
